<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    lizongbo 的 編程學(xué)習(xí)

    http://618119.com

    BlogJava 首頁(yè) 新隨筆 聯(lián)系 聚合 管理
      23 Posts :: 1 Stories :: 78 Comments :: 0 Trackbacks

    在對(duì)一個(gè)map進(jìn)行迭代遍歷并刪除一些符合條件的鍵值對(duì)的時(shí)候,容易出現(xiàn)

         java.util.ConcurrentModificationException 這個(gè)異常。
    Exception in thread "main" java.util.ConcurrentModificationException
     at java.util.HashMap$HashIterator.nextEntry(HashMap.java:787)
     at java.util.HashMap$KeyIterator.next(HashMap.java:823)

    解決辦法如下:

    import java.util.*;

    public class TestMap {
      public TestMap() {
      }

      public static void main(String[] args) {
        java.util.Map m = new java.util.HashMap();
        m.put("aaa", "lizongbo ");
        m.put("bbb", " lizongbo");
        m.put("ccc", "lizongbo  ");
        m.put("ddd", "  lizongbo");
        m.put("eee", "lizongbo");
        m.put("fff", "lizongbo");
        m.put("ggg", "lizongbo");
        m.put("adads", "lizongbo");
        m.put("dffd", "lizongbo");
        m.put("dcxv", "lizongbo");
        m.put("lizongbo", "lizongbo");
        m.put("ert", "lizongbo");
        m.put("544", "lizongbo ");
        Iterator iterator = m.keySet().iterator();
        while (iterator.hasNext()) {
          String sessionId = (String) iterator.next();
          if ("ggg".equals(sessionId) || "lizongbo".equals(sessionId) ||
              "544".equals(sessionId)) {
            iterator.remove();       //這行代碼是關(guān)鍵。
            m.remove(sessionId);
          }
        }
        System.out.println(m.get("ggg"));
        System.out.println(m.get("lizongbo"));
        System.out.println(m.get("544"));
      }

            相關(guān)參考: http://ldfren.bosinet.com/archives/113.html
    http://gceclub.sun.com.cn/yuanchuang/week-14/iterator.html

    posted on 2006-02-27 10:12 lizongbo 的編程學(xué)習(xí) 閱讀(2227) 評(píng)論(0)  編輯  收藏 所屬分類: java 積累
    主站蜘蛛池模板: 亚洲精品乱码久久久久久| 国产日韩AV免费无码一区二区| 四虎成人精品一区二区免费网站 | 水蜜桃视频在线观看免费| 亚洲黄色免费在线观看| 亚洲线精品一区二区三区| 国产精品四虎在线观看免费| 四虎永久在线观看免费网站网址| 一级特级aaaa毛片免费观看| 亚洲欧美国产欧美色欲| 亚洲电影在线免费观看| 亚洲AV日韩精品久久久久| 国产亚洲精品自在线观看| 亚洲高清免费视频| 日本19禁啪啪无遮挡免费动图| 香港a毛片免费观看 | 最新免费jlzzjlzz在线播放| 无码人妻丰满熟妇区免费 | 在线观看亚洲精品国产| 亚洲国产综合人成综合网站| 亚洲欧美日本韩国| 亚洲高清最新av网站| 在线毛片片免费观看| 亚洲av无码潮喷在线观看| 99久在线国内在线播放免费观看| 精品亚洲一区二区三区在线观看| 一级全免费视频播放| 国产精品亚洲аv无码播放| 成人浮力影院免费看| 四虎影视在线看免费观看| 69式国产真人免费视频| 亚洲第一成年免费网站| 国产高清视频在线免费观看| 亚洲日韩国产一区二区三区| 亚洲视频.com| 亚洲精品国产日韩| 免费国产a理论片| 99久热只有精品视频免费看| 日本免费网站在线观看| 亚洲色爱图小说专区| 91亚洲精品自在在线观看|